diff options
Diffstat (limited to 'cc/playback/display_list_recording_source_unittest.cc')
-rw-r--r-- | cc/playback/display_list_recording_source_unittest.cc |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/cc/playback/display_list_recording_source_unittest.cc b/cc/playback/display_list_recording_source_unittest.cc index 1649566..3b619bb 100644 --- a/cc/playback/display_list_recording_source_unittest.cc +++ b/cc/playback/display_list_recording_source_unittest.cc @@ -9,6 +9,7 @@ #include "cc/proto/display_list_recording_source.pb.h" #include "cc/test/fake_content_layer_client.h" #include "cc/test/fake_display_list_recording_source.h" +#include "cc/test/fake_image_serialization_processor.h" #include "cc/test/skia_common.h" #include "testing/gtest/include/gtest/gtest.h" @@ -33,11 +34,15 @@ scoped_refptr<DisplayListRasterSource> CreateRasterSource( void ValidateRecordingSourceSerialization( FakeDisplayListRecordingSource* source) { + scoped_ptr<FakeImageSerializationProcessor> + fake_image_serialization_processor = + make_scoped_ptr(new FakeImageSerializationProcessor); + proto::DisplayListRecordingSource proto; - source->ToProtobuf(&proto); + source->ToProtobuf(&proto, fake_image_serialization_processor.get()); FakeDisplayListRecordingSource new_source; - new_source.FromProtobuf(proto); + new_source.FromProtobuf(proto, fake_image_serialization_processor.get()); EXPECT_TRUE(source->EqualsTo(new_source)); } |